How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Hyde Park?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Hyde Park Studio Apartments | $1,089 | $700 | $1,550 |
Hyde Park 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,352 | $825 | $2,130 |
| Hyde Park 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,056 | $1,025 | $10,000+ |
| Hyde Park 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,411 | $1,505 | $2,920 |
| Hyde Park 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,299 | $1,899 | $2,700 |
